Herunterladen Inhalt Inhalt Diese Seite drucken

Siemens SINUMERIK 840D sl Handbuch Für Fortgeschrittene Seite 568

Vorschau ausblenden Andere Handbücher für SINUMERIK 840D sl:
Inhaltsverzeichnis

Werbung

NC-Maschinendaten
3.3 Achsspezifische NC-Maschinendaten
32760
COMP_ADD_VELO_FACTOR
-
Geschwindigkeitsüberhöhung durch Kompensation
CTEQ
-
-
Beschreibung:
Durch das axiale MD32760 $MA_COMP_ADD_VELO_FACTOR kann die maximale Strecke,
die durch die Temperaturkompensation in einem IPO-Takt verfahrbar ist,
begrenzt werden.
Liegt der resultierende Temperaturkompensationswert über diesem Maximalwert,
so wird der Wert in mehreren IPO-Taktzyklen verfahren. Es erfolgt keine
Alarmmeldung.
Der maximale Kompensationswert pro IPO-Takt wird als Faktor bezogen auf die
maximale Achsgeschwindigkeit (MD32000 $MA_MAX_AX_VELO) vorgegeben.
Durch dieses Maschinendatum wird auch der maximale Steigungswinkel der Tempe-
raturkompensation tanbmax begrenzt.
Beispiel für die Ermittlung des maximalen Steigungswinkels tanb(max):
1.
Geschwindigkeiten, Soll-/Istwertsystem, Taktzeiten (G2))
Interpolator-Taktzeit = Systemgrundtakt ^ Faktor für Interpolatortakt
Interpolator-Taktzeit = MD10050 $MN_SYSCLOCK_CYCLE_TIME ^ MD10070
$MN_IPO_SYSCLOCK_TIME_RATIO
Beispiel:
2.
Temperaturkompensationsparameters DvTmax
DvTmax
Beispiel: MD32000 $MA_MAX_AX_VELO = 10 000 [mm/min]
3.
4.
Bei größeren Wertvorgaben von SD43910 $SA_TEMP_COMP_SLOPE wird steuerungs-
intern der maximale Steigungswinkel (hier 0,57 Grad) für den positionsab-
hängigen Temperaturkompensationswert verwendet. Es erfolgt keine
Alarmmeldung.
Hinweis:
Bei der Festlegung des Schwellwertes für die Geschwindigkeitsüberwachung
(MD36200 $MA_AX_VELO_LIMIT) ist ggf. die durch die Temperaturkompensation
zusätzliche Geschwindigkeitsüberhöhung zu berücksichtigen.
568
0.01
Ermittlung der Interpolator-Taktzeit (siehe Funktionsbeschreibung
MD10050 $MN_SYSCLOCK_CYCLE_TIME = 0,004 [s]
MD10070 $MN_IPO_SYSCLOCK_TIME_RATIO = 3
--> Interpolator-Taktzeit = 0,004 * 3 = 0,012 [s]
Ermittlung der maximalen Geschwindigkeitserhöhung infolge Änderung des
= MD32000 $MA_MAX_AX_VELO * MD32760 $MA_COMP_ADD_VELO_FACTOR
MD32760 $MA_COMP_ADD_VELO_FACTOR = 0,01
--> DvTmax = 10 000 ^0,01 = 100 [mm/min]
Ermittlung der Verfahrstrecken pro Interpolator-Taktzeit
S1 (bei vmax)
= 10 000
ST (bei DvTmax)
=
Ermittlung von tanbmax
tanbmax
=
--> bmax = arc tan 0,01 = 0,57 Grad
EXP, A09, A04 K3
DOUBLE
0.
0.10
0,012
x
-------
60
0,012
100
x
------
60
ST
0,02
----
= ------
S1
2
NEW CONF
7/2
M
= 2,0 [mm]
= 0,02 [mm]
= 0,01 (entspricht dem Wert von
COMP_ADD_VELO_FACTOR)
Ausführliche Beschreibung der Maschinendaten
Listenhandbuch, 02/2011, -

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is